#319906 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#319906 is composed of 19.2% red, 60%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68% cyan, 0% magenta, 96.1%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 102.4 degrees, a saturation of 92.5% and a lightness of 31.2%. #319906 color hex could be obtained by blending #62ff0c with #003300.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

#319906 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#319906 has RGB values of R:49, G:153, B:6 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0, Y:0.96,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 3250438.
